Source format

M4V

M4V is a video container format developed by Apple, primarily used for their iTunes Store content. It's essentially an MP4 file with DRM protection often applied. M4V files can contain video and audio streams, supporting various codecs like H.264 and AAC. While widely compatible with Apple devices like iPhones, iPads, and iPods, its use outside the Apple ecosystem can be limited due to potential DRM and its association with video rather than standalone audio.

Target format

OPUS

OPUS is an open-source, highly versatile audio codec developed by the Xiph.Org Foundation. It's designed for interactive applications like voice over IP (VoIP), video conferencing, and as a general-purpose audio format. OPUS excels at delivering high-quality audio across a wide range of bitrates, from narrowband speech to stereo music, and is known for its low latency and robustness. It's widely supported in modern web browsers and applications, making it an excellent choice for efficient audio storage and streaming.

M4V vs OPUS

M4V is primarily a video container format, often associated with Apple's ecosystem and potentially DRM-protected, designed to hold video and audio streams. OPUS, on the other hand, is a specialized, highly efficient audio codec optimized for both speech and music across a vast range of bitrates and network conditions. While M4V's audio component might be AAC or MP3, OPUS offers superior compression and quality, especially at lower bitrates, making it more suitable for audio-only applications, streaming, and archiving where file size and quality are paramount. Converting M4V to OPUS allows you to isolate and optimize the audio for broader compatibility and efficiency.
